Specifications
Series: --
Packaging: Tray 
Part Status: Obsolete
Memory Type: Volatile
Memory Format: DRAM
Technology: SDRAM - Mobile LPDDR2
Memory Size: 512Mb (16M x 32)
Clock Frequency: 400MHz
Write Cycle Time - Word, Page: --
Memory Interface: Parallel
Voltage - Supply: 1.14 V ~ 1.3 V
Operating Temperature: -40°C ~ 85°C (TC)
Mounting Type: Surface Mount
Package / Case: 134-VFBGA
Supplier Device Package: 134-VFBGA (10x11.5)
